Below you will find our most frequently asked questions about the application process to study online with King's and key information about the courses.

 

Applying for a King’s Online programme is quick and our Online Admissions Fact Sheet will take you through the application process step-by-step. After uploading your supporting documents and submitting your application, the King’s Admissions team will review it and submit a response within five working days if you meet the entry criteria. If your application needs to be assessed further, it could take longer. If there is documentation missing, your Enrolment Advisor may ask you to upload further details before your application can be processed, which may cause a delay to your response. In total, your application should take no more than two weeks from your application being submitted to a decision being made.

The minimum time to complete a full master’s is two years. However, if a PG Certificate or PG Diploma is available then you can finish sooner but without a full master’s degree. The maximum time you can take to complete your master’s degree is six years. The great thing about online learning is that it can fit around your life and work commitments. If you need to take a break from your studies you can get in touch with your Student Success Advisor. They will help you understand the amount of time that will be added onto your studies as a result of the interruption, and will work with you to ensure that your return is as seamless and as expedient as possible. We would note though, that while our model is designed to help you get you back onto the programme as quickly as possible, any pause in study will delay your graduation date.

If you have completed a qualification with a related level and syllabus to one of our courses, exemptions are considered on a case by case basis by the programme director and in accordance with the King's policy on recognition of prior learning. Please discuss this with your Enrolment Advisor during the application process.

Visit our Postgraduate Fees and Funding page to find out more about how to fund your studies and what scholarships could be available to you. Online learning offers you the flexibility to pay for one module at a time. The only upfront financial commitment you need to make is for the first module.

The delivery method of your master’s is not added to your degree certificate. You will receive the same certificate as a student who studied full-time on-campus. And just like an on-campus student, you will be invited to a graduation ceremony in London so you can celebrate your achievement.
